What is AI?
Artificial Intelligence (AI) is no longer a concept of science fiction. It's a transformative force reshaping our world. AI involves creating machines that can perform tasks that typically require human intelligence. This includes learning, problem-solving, and decision-making.
AI systems are designed to analyze data, identify patterns, and make predictions. These systems can adapt and improve over time through machine learning algorithms. AI's capabilities span across various domains, making it a versatile tool with broad applications.
From enhancing existing industries to creating entirely new possibilities, AI is revolutionizing various facets of our lives. It impacts everything from healthcare and education to the economy and society at large.

AI in Healthcare
Artificial Intelligence is transforming healthcare, enhancing diagnostics, treatment, and patient care. 🏥
Improved Diagnostics
AI algorithms can analyze medical images (X-rays, MRIs, CT scans) to detect diseases earlier and more accurately than human experts. This leads to quicker diagnoses and better patient outcomes.
Personalized Treatment
AI can analyze patient data to create personalized treatment plans. This approach considers individual factors like genetics, lifestyle, and medical history to optimize treatment effectiveness and minimize side effects.
Drug Discovery
AI accelerates drug discovery by analyzing vast datasets to identify potential drug candidates and predict their effectiveness. This significantly reduces the time and cost associated with developing new medications. 💊
Robotic Surgery
AI-powered robots assist surgeons with complex procedures, enhancing precision, reducing invasiveness, and shortening recovery times. These robots can perform intricate movements with greater accuracy than human hands.
AI-Powered Virtual Assistants
Virtual assistants and chatbots provide patients with 24/7 access to medical information, appointment scheduling, and medication reminders. They also help monitor patients remotely, improving adherence to treatment plans.
Predictive Analytics
AI algorithms can predict disease outbreaks, patient readmission rates, and other critical healthcare trends. This enables healthcare providers to allocate resources more efficiently and proactively address potential health crises. 💡
Challenges and Considerations
While AI offers numerous benefits, it also raises important questions about data privacy, algorithmic bias, and the potential for job displacement. Addressing these concerns is crucial to ensure the responsible and equitable implementation of AI in healthcare.
AI in Education
Artificial Intelligence is rapidly changing the landscape of education. AI's influence spans from personalized learning experiences to automating administrative tasks, offering both opportunities and challenges for educators and students alike. 🚀
Personalized Learning
AI algorithms can analyze student data to create personalized learning paths. This tailored approach addresses individual needs, offering customized content, pacing, and feedback. Adaptive learning platforms use AI to identify knowledge gaps and adjust the curriculum accordingly, ensuring students receive targeted support. 🎯
Automated Grading & Feedback
AI-powered tools automate the grading process for objective assessments, like multiple-choice quizzes, freeing up educators' time. These systems provide immediate feedback to students, enhancing their understanding and retention. AI can also assist in evaluating essays and open-ended questions, offering insights into students' reasoning and writing skills. 📝
AI-Driven Tutoring Systems
AI-driven tutoring systems provide students with on-demand support and guidance. These virtual tutors can answer questions, explain concepts, and offer practice exercises, supplementing traditional classroom instruction. AI tutors are accessible 24/7, making learning more convenient and flexible for students. 💡
Enhancing Accessibility
AI improves accessibility for students with disabilities through tools like speech-to-text and text-to-speech software. These technologies enable students with visual or auditory impairments to participate more fully in the learning process. AI-powered translation tools also break down language barriers, facilitating communication and understanding in diverse classrooms. 🌐
Challenges & Considerations
Despite its potential, AI in education raises concerns about data privacy, algorithmic bias, and the over-reliance on technology. It is crucial to address these ethical considerations and ensure that AI is used responsibly and equitably to enhance, not replace, human interaction in education. 🤔

Ethical Concerns of AI
As AI becomes more integrated into our lives, it's crucial to address the ethical considerations that arise. These concerns span various areas, impacting individuals, society, and the future of technology.
Job Displacement
One of the primary ethical concerns is the potential for widespread job displacement. As AI-powered systems become capable of performing tasks previously done by humans, many fear significant unemployment. It's essential to consider how to mitigate this impact through:
- Retraining programs: Equipping workers with the skills needed for new roles in the AI-driven economy.
- Universal basic income: Providing a safety net for those whose jobs are displaced.
- Focus on human-AI collaboration: Emphasizing how AI can augment human capabilities rather than replace them entirely.
Bias and Discrimination
AI systems are trained on data, and if that data reflects existing societal biases, the AI will perpetuate and even amplify those biases. This can lead to discriminatory outcomes in areas such as:
- Hiring: AI-powered recruiting tools may discriminate against certain demographics.
- Lending: Algorithms used to assess creditworthiness may unfairly deny loans to certain groups.
- Criminal justice: Predictive policing algorithms may disproportionately target specific communities.
Addressing bias in AI requires careful attention to data collection, algorithm design, and ongoing monitoring to ensure fairness and equity.
Privacy and Surveillance
AI systems often rely on vast amounts of data, raising concerns about privacy and surveillance. The collection, storage, and use of personal data must be handled responsibly to protect individuals' rights. Key considerations include:
- Data security: Protecting data from breaches and unauthorized access.
- Transparency: Being clear about how data is being used and giving individuals control over their information.
- Regulation: Establishing legal frameworks to govern the use of AI and protect privacy rights.
Autonomous Weapons
The development of autonomous weapons systems (AWS), also known as "killer robots," raises profound ethical questions. These weapons can select and engage targets without human intervention. Concerns include:
- Accountability: Determining who is responsible when an AWS makes a mistake or causes unintended harm.
- Risk of escalation: The potential for AWS to lower the threshold for conflict and lead to unintended escalation.
- Moral implications: The idea of machines making life-or-death decisions without human oversight.
There is a growing call for international agreements to regulate or ban the development and use of AWS.
The Responsibility of AI Developers
AI developers have a significant ethical responsibility to ensure their creations are used for good and do not cause harm. This includes:
- Ethical design: Incorporating ethical considerations into the design and development process.
- Transparency: Being open about the limitations and potential risks of AI systems.
- Collaboration: Working with ethicists, policymakers, and the public to address ethical concerns.
By addressing these ethical concerns proactively, we can harness the power of AI for the benefit of all humanity.

The Future Job Market
AI is rapidly transforming the job market, leading to significant shifts in required skills and employment opportunities. While some jobs may become obsolete, AI is also creating new roles and industries.
Historically, technological advancements have always reshaped the job landscape. The rise of smartphones eliminated the need for landline operators, and the advent of cars reduced the demand for horse carriage drivers. Similarly, ATMs impacted bank tellers, and online platforms affected booking clerks. Industrial robots led to job losses for assembly line workers. However, AI's impact is broader, affecting nearly every sector, including creative fields.
Creative roles, such as graphic designers, logo designers, and musicians, are now at risk. AI software can generate images, logos, and graphics within minutes. Google's music model allows users to create custom music by specifying instruments and styles.
The World Economic Forum's Future of Jobs Report 2020 estimates that AI could eliminate 85 million jobs by 2025. However, it also predicts the creation of 97 million new jobs in the same period. This highlights that AI is not a job killer but a job category killer.
Emerging jobs will increasingly require AI-related skills. For example, while a graphic designer might lose their job, there will be a greater need for individuals who can provide instructions to AI for creating logos and modify AI-generated outputs. The saying goes, "AI won't take your job, but a person knowing AI will."
Adapting to this new world is crucial. Acquiring AI skills is becoming a new standard for job seekers, similar to the necessity of basic computer knowledge today.
